Assessment of ADD through tests

There are many tests for adults to add assessment. These tests are used to test for impulsivity or attention issues. The evaluation should include interviews with the patient as well as standardized ADHD behavior rating scales.

One type of computer-based test, the Test of Variables of Attention (TOVA), is FDA-cleared to screen for ADHD. It tests auditory and visual processing skills. Children and adults take this test for 21.6 minutes. They are given simple geometric shapes to use as targets during the test. They are required to push a micro switch while the target is displayed. It is not necessary to press the micro switch if they are hearing a toneor other stimulus.

The Quantified Behavior Test (QbTest) is a mixture of attention and impulsivity measures as well as motion tracking analysis. It is a clinical tool that can be useful in evaluating the effect of stimulant medication. It can also be used to detect fidgetiness. It can also provide information on the effectiveness of neurofeedback.
